Frito Pie

Crunchy, cheesy, and loaded with big bold flavors, Frito Pie is the perfect comfort food dinner or appetizer, ready in under 30 minutes!
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time15 minutes
Total Time25 minutes
Course: Appetizer
Cuisine: American
Servings: 4
Calories: 491kcal
Author: Teri & Jenny

Ingredients

  • 6 oz fritos
  • 1 cup chili
  • 4 ounces sh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 2 roma tomatoes seeded and diced
  • 1/3 cup diced white onion
  • 1/2 cup sliced pickled  jalapeños drained
  • 2 green onions thinly sliced on a bias

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 400˚F.
  • Pour Fritos onto a sheet pan and spread into an even layer.
  • Top Fritos with chili.
  • Sprinkle shredded cheese evenly over chili.
  • Place skillet in oven and bake until cheese has melted, 4 to 5 minutes.
  • Remove from oven and dollop with sour cream.
  • Top with diced tomatoes, onion, green onion, and pickled jalapeños. Serve immediately.

Notes

Prepping Ingredients Ahead of Time
The key to whipping up this Frito pie in a snap is having your ingredients ready to assemble.
  • Make the chili up to 3-5 days before making your Frito pie. Just store the chili in an airtight container in the refrigerator.
  • You can also have your toppings chopped and ready to go up to 2 days before making this recipe. Store the diced tomato, diced onion, and sliced green onion in separate containers until ready to use.
Making Chili Ahead of Time
Anytime you make chili, make sure to save a couple of cups for this recipe! Leftovers will stay good in the refrigerator for up to 3-5 days.
In fact, you may as well make a double batch of chili and freeze leftovers so that it's ready to go whenever the craving for Frito Pie hits. Chili can be stored in the freezer for up to three months.
When you're ready to make your Frito Chili Pie, all you have to do is take your chili out of the freezer, thaw it, and add it to the pie.
